The Lawrence Conservatory’s New Music Series presents Spectral Canvas, an evening of bold, boundary-crossing music by Donnacha Dennehy and Andy Akiho. The program features Dennehy’s “Limina”, a riveting piano concerto performed by Lawrence faculty pianist Michael Mizrahi. In “Limina”, Dennehy explores thresholds between registers, textures, and energies, creating music that is at once luminous, visceral, and deeply expressive.
Paired with Dennehy’s work is Akiho’s “Copper Canvas”, a dazzling composition alive with intricate grooves, metallic shimmer, and the kinetic drive that has made Akiho one of today’s most in-demand composers.
Hailed by critics worldwide, Dennehy and Akiho represent two of the most distinctive voices in contemporary music. Together, their works invite listeners to step into soundscapes that shimmer, pulse, and radiate with color and intensity.
